Urwerk continues its exploration of time across civilizations and today unveils an extraordinary piece: the UR-100V Time & Culture III. This one-of-a-kind piece is the result of an unprecedented artistic collaboration between the Swiss watchmaker and David Kakabadze Studio in Tbilisi, Georgia.
URWERK’s “Time & Culture” collection celebrates the fundamental concept of time transcription, embarking on a journey of remembrance across civilizations. After exploring Native American and Mesopotamian symbolism, the new UR-100V “Time & Culture” takes us to the heart of Georgian Orthodox tradition, a land where spirituality, religion and art have been closely intertwined for centuries.
Handcrafted Art
The UR-100V Time & Culture III watch is adorned in gold and is a masterpiece of 24K cloisonné enamel and miniature painting. The work took 1,152 days to create, using 19 different enamels and fired 16 times at 750°C. Every step, every color, every curve bears witness to the long-standing skills passed down by the masters of the Kakabadze workshop.
Inspired by a fragment of a zodiac fresco in the Svetitskhoveli Cathedral, a treasure of Georgian cultural heritage, this work is a tribute to the Christian liturgy: According to ancient legend, a man named Elias witnessed the crucifixion of Jesus and brought the robe of Jesus to Georgia. When his sister Sidonia touched the robe, she was so moved that she clutched it until she died. Unable to take the robe away from her hands, she was buried in the tomb with the robe, and a cedar tree grew from her grave. In the 4th century, King Mirian III converted to Christianity and built the first church in Georgia on what is believed to be the Sidonia cemetery.
The design of the UR-100V Time & Culture III depicts Christ surrounded by 12 celestial symbols, representing the 12 cycles of time: 12 months, 12 hours, 12 constellations.
Underneath this work of art, the UR 12.01 movement is on board. Time is displayed via a satellite-style hour display, a signature feature of URWERK.

Urwerk UR-100V Time & Culture III
Unique piece
Case
Material: 2N 18K yellow gold.
Dimensions Width: 41 mm, Length: 49.70 mm, Thickness: 14 mm Crystal: Sapphire crystal Water-resistant to 3ATM (30 meters) Movement
Automatic winding UR 12.02 calibre, controlled by Windfänger propeller Number of jewels: 40 Frequency: 4 Hz, 28'800 vph Power reserve 48 hours Material: Aluminium satellite hours on beryllium bronze Geneva cross mechanism; Aluminium carousel; ARCAP alloy carousel and triple bottom plate. Finishing
Circular satin-brushed, sandblasted, shot-peened, circular satin-finished, circular wood graining Polished screw heads Hours and minutes painted in Super-LumiNova Dome under the sapphire in 24K gold cloisonné enamelling Functions/Indications
Satellite hours; minutes Strap and buckle
Alcantara and leather, 2N 18K yellow gold pin buckle
